  • This sounds like a bargain. Hyundai are quoting me $350 for the 30k (2 year) service on my i45. As long as these guys do the service according to the handbook that's a huge saving.

    • do you believe it?

    • actually as long as they stamp the log book, you can then do it youself - i atleast trust myself to do it :D.

    • I've had major/minor services done by different people and the majority won't stamp a log book as a logbook service often includes more things depending on what stage service your up to (and even if it doesn't, they still want to charge more for a logbook service).
